Verdict

Inglis Drever will prove hard to stop in his hat-trick bid and gets a confident vote over the progressive Neptune Collonges and Brewster, Baracouda won this 12 months ago, and of course he has already been eclipsed by the new star in the staying ranks Inglis Drever, who has took over the mantle after beating the French star twice already, at Cheltenham in March and more recently at Newbury. With form like that, there is no way that any of today's opposition can be recommended to cause an upset. There is of course another French-bred here in the shape of Neptune Collonges who revels in testing ground and is seen as a future star by connections. They may have to wait a while for him to fulfill his potential though and he looks booked for second place at best. Brewster will come on for his return and is used to mixing it with the best, but he surely cannot beat the selection off levels, and all in all it has to be a case of one-way traffic, with all roads leading to Inglish Drever.
